On the back of a disturbing story I heard last week about blogging domain names being renewed by third parties at 12 midnight on the day of their expiry date.  Then the blog's domain name being offered back for sale, to their original owner at a ridiculous price, I thought I had better turn on my old computer to check my godaddy account, as I hadn't heard from them for a while.

And if you run your blog as a godaddy account, check its renewal date and make sure you get there before the vultures do. Sad that there are these kind of people out there.

  7. Hi Carolyn! Great reminder. You can also set your GoDaddy account to automatically renew. I keep the card on file that I used to purchase both my domain names and it renews every year without me having to remember. It always sends a reminder that it's getting ready to renew so IF someone didn't want to renew for some reason they could always cancel. I look at it like insurance for our blog. lol

    When you spend so much time building a blog up you certainly don't want to lose your domain name to someone else. Thanks for sharing this reminder with us at Inspiration Friday!
